Abstract :
Simple equations that characterize the offtrack performance of magnetic recording heads with magnetoresistive read are derived. The validity of the equations is illustrated with experimental data. It is shown how these equations can be used to derive the optimum write and read trackwidth for a given application or to derive the track-density potential of a given head. Only one parameter, called the k-factor, is used in addition to the physical head trackwidth. The k-factor can be readily found experimentally for a given design, and once it is known, the design optimization becomes relatively simple
